什么是Git?
Git是一個分布式版本控制系統(tǒng),用于追蹤文件的更改并協(xié)調(diào)多個人員之間的工作。它可以記錄每個文件的歷史變更,方便團隊成員之間的協(xié)作和代碼管理。Git的強大之處在于它的操作記錄功能,可以幫助用戶查看文件的修改歷史和操作記錄。
Git的操作記錄功能
Git的操作記錄功能可以幫助用戶查看文件的修改歷史和操作記錄。通過Git的命令行工具或者圖形化界面工具,用戶可以輕松地查看文件的每次修改、提交的時間、提交者等詳細信息。操作記錄功能可以幫助用戶追蹤文件的變更,查找特定版本的文件內(nèi)容,以及定位問題和解決沖突。
查看Git操作記錄的命令
Git提供了一系列命令來查看操作記錄。其中最常用的命令是git log,它可以顯示提交歷史記錄。通過git log命令,用戶可以查看每次提交的哈希值、作者、提交時間、提交信息等。用戶還可以使用git diff命令來比較不同版本之間的差異,git blame命令來查看每行代碼的修改者等。
圖形化界面工具
除了命令行工具,Git還提供了圖形化界面工具來幫助用戶查看操作記錄。其中最常用的圖形化界面工具是Git GUI和SourceTree。這些工具提供了更直觀的界面,用戶可以通過可視化的方式查看提交歷史、文件變更、分支情況等。圖形化界面工具通常更適合初學(xué)者使用,對于不熟悉命令行的用戶來說更加友好。
查看操作記錄的應(yīng)用場景
查看操作記錄在軟件開發(fā)過程中非常重要。它可以幫助開發(fā)人員追蹤代碼的變更,查找特定版本的代碼,定位問題和解決沖突。操作記錄還可以用于代碼審查,團隊成員可以通過查看操作記錄來了解其他成員的工作進展和代碼質(zhì)量。操作記錄還可以用于項目管理,團隊可以通過查看操作記錄來評估項目進度和成員貢獻度。
操作記錄的最佳實踐
為了充分利用Git的操作記錄功能,有一些最佳實踐值得注意。每次提交都應(yīng)該附帶有意義的提交信息,這樣可以方便其他人理解每次提交的目的和內(nèi)容。及時提交和推送代碼,避免長時間的本地修改,以免造成沖突和代碼丟失。定期清理操作記錄,刪除不必要的提交,保持操作記錄的整潔和可讀性。
操作記錄的優(yōu)勢
Git的操作記錄功能具有許多優(yōu)勢。它可以幫助用戶追蹤文件的變更,查找特定版本的文件內(nèi)容,以及定位問題和解決沖突。操作記錄可以提高團隊的協(xié)作效率,團隊成員可以通過查看操作記錄了解其他成員的工作進展和代碼質(zhì)量。操作記錄可以用于項目管理和評估,團隊可以通過查看操作記錄來評估項目進度和成員貢獻度。
Git的操作記錄功能是一個強大的工具,可以幫助用戶查看文件的修改歷史和操作記錄。通過Git的命令行工具或者圖形化界面工具,用戶可以輕松地查看文件的每次修改、提交的時間、提交者等詳細信息。操作記錄功能可以幫助用戶追蹤文件的變更,查找特定版本的文件內(nèi)容,以及定位問題和解決沖突。在軟件開發(fā)過程中,操作記錄是一個非常重要的工具,可以提高團隊的協(xié)作效率和項目管理能力。